Foamstars Announces Worldwide Open Beta Party

Square Enix has announced a playable worldwide open beta for Foamstars, its brand-new foam party shooter exclusive to PlayStation, which will commence on September 29. Revealed during today’s State of Play broadcast, the Foamstars Open Beta Party invites PlayStation 5 players to experience this over-the-top, chaotically foamy competitive shooter in advance of its official early 2024 release. Access to the beta is free and available to download from the PlayStation™ Store when live.

When is the Foamstars Open Bata Party?

Friday, September 29 @ 6pm PDT – Sunday, October 1 @ 11.59pm PDT

How do I Join the Foamstars Open Beta Party?

Download the Foamstars Open Beta Party game software via the PlayStation Store and launch the game on a PlayStation 5 console during the event period to participate for free. A PlayStation Plus subscription is not required to join the open beta.

What is the Foamstars Open Beta Party?

In the upcoming Foamstars Open Beta Party, players will experience two different 4-v-4 game modes and choose from eight diverse and vibrant characters, each with their own play style, specialist weapons, and unique game-changing skills. With foam as each challenger’s weapon of choice, players must master the game’s foam traversal and construction mechanics to build, block, and overpower their competitors to achieve victory.

As a thank you to every player who participates in the open beta, an exclusive cosmetic item for the character Soa will be given upon downloading the full game at launch.

Two available game modes:

  • “Smash the Star”: Compete in a frantic battle where the winning strategy changes as the match progresses. In this mode each team must battle it out to secure seven knockouts on the opposing team. Once this is achieved, the best player is chosen to be the “Star Player” and becomes the key to victory! To win the match, teams must defeat the opposing team’s “Star Player” while also protecting their own!
  • “Happy Bath Survival”: A battle between two teams comprised of two “infield” players and two “outfield” players. Victory is earned by defeating both opponent “infield” players, while “outfield” players support and provide defense for their teammates!

Foamstars puts players in the vibrant world of Bath Vegas, a gorgeous and bubbly metropolis, and the setting for the world’s biggest foam party fit with the neon and the city. Foamstars blasts players into the ultimate, over-the-top online shooter, that pits teams of up to 4 against each other in an easily accessible gameplay experience using foam! Prepare to experience a fraction of what Foamstars has to offer while simultaneously testing the capabilities of our servers ahead of the game’s upcoming launch in 2024.
